Top 5 Basketball Games on Android in the UK: Q1 2025

In the first quarter of 2025, basketball gaming enthusiasts in the United Kingdom showed varied engagement with the top five Android basketball games. Here's a look at their performance, based on data from Sensor Tower.

Basket Battle saw a fluctuating trend in weekly revenue, starting at about $14 and peaking at $26 in mid-March. Weekly downloads began at around 5.6K, gradually declining to just over 2K by the end of March. Active users decreased from 66.2K to 50.9K over the quarter.

NBA 2K25 MyTEAM recorded weekly revenue starting at $1K, with a high of $1.9K in mid-February. Downloads peaked at 3.8K during the same period, with active users increasing from 2.8K to a peak of 5K before settling at 3.7K.

NBA LIVE Mobile Basketball experienced a peak in revenue of $155 in mid-March. Weekly downloads varied, hitting a high of 3.8K in early January, while active users showed a slight upward trend, reaching 18.8K in mid-February before declining to 14.6K by quarter's end.

Basketball Stars: Multiplayer had a notable revenue increase to $643 in early February. Downloads peaked at 3.1K early in the quarter, with active users rising to 9.4K in mid-February before ending at 6.3K.

Dribble Hoops maintained modest revenue, peaking at $7 in early February. Downloads reached a high of 2.9K in mid-February, while active users saw a peak of 7.9K before dropping to 2.9K by the end of March.
